are narrow-diameter, unmyelinated sensory nerve fibers that transmit signals from pleasant touch. A. P tactile efferents B. C ta
KIM [24]

Answer:

Option E, C tactile (CT) afferent

Explanation:

Whenever a slow moving gentle touch experienced, the response is due to the nerve fibers called C-Tactile afferents (CTs).  

C-Tactile afferents (CTs) are unmyelinated mechanoreceptors  of low threshold and low conduction velocities.  

In humans, CT neurons are found in hairy skin.
